Neuberger (NBXG), a closed-end fund focused on investments across the global next-generation connectivity ecosystem, has no recent formal earnings data available for public release as of the current date. The fund’s portfolio spans a range of connectivity-focused assets including telecom infrastructure operators, edge computing service providers, hardware manufacturers enabling 5G and future 6G networks, and rural broadband deployment firms. Management Commentary
While formal earnings metrics are not yet publicly available, Neuberger’s senior portfolio management team shared insights during a recent public investor webinar focused on the fund’s recent positioning moves. The team noted that they have adjusted portfolio weightings modestly in the latest completed quarter to increase exposure to small and mid-cap firms developing low-orbit satellite connectivity and advanced fiber optic hardware, segments they believe may see accelerating demand from both enterprise clients and public sector agencies in the coming periods. The team also highlighted that they are closely monitoring potential supply chain bottlenecks for critical semiconductor components used in connectivity hardware, which could possibly impact the near-term profitability of a small subset of the fund’s holdings. They added that NBXG’s significant allocation to regulated, revenue-generating telecom infrastructure assets could offer a degree of defensive stability amid broader market volatility, though this potential benefit is not guaranteed.

Forward Guidance
In line with standard operating practices for closed-end funds of its type, Neuberger (NBXG) has not issued formal quantitative forward guidance for upcoming periods. The portfolio management team has signaled that they would likely continue rebalancing the fund’s holdings over the coming months to align with shifting connectivity industry trends, including potential increases to exposure of internet of things (IoT) connectivity solution providers if market adoption rates track close to their base case projections. The team also noted that pending changes to federal rural broadband funding allocations could create potential upside for a portion of the fund’s existing holdings, though final policy outcomes remain uncertain as of this writing. They added that they will continue to hedge a portion of the fund’s interest rate risk to mitigate potential impacts of rising rates on the valuation of long-duration infrastructure assets.

Market Reaction
Analysts covering NBXG have noted that the fund’s recent trading performance has largely tracked the performance of peer connectivity-focused investment vehicles, with no significant divergence observed that would signal unanticipated changes to the fund’s underlying value. Market expectations for NBXG’s long-term performance are closely tied to broader trends in global corporate capital expenditure on digital connectivity upgrades, as well as regulatory decisions that impact the operating costs of telecom infrastructure providers. Some analysts estimate that the fund’s focus on next-generation connectivity segments could position it to benefit from long-term industry growth trends, though they caution that near-term macroeconomic headwinds could lead to increased price volatility for NBXG shares.
